оптимизация |
оптимизация |
bigglewood |
Сообщение
#1
|
Пионер Группа: Пользователи Сообщений: 55 Пол: Мужской Репутация: 0 |
помогите пожалуйста найти пример оптимизации методом "простейшего перебора" спасибо.
|
Lapp |
Сообщение
#2
|
Уникум Группа: Пользователи Сообщений: 6 823 Пол: Мужской Реальное имя: Лопáрь (Андрей) Репутация: 159 |
пример оптимизации методом "простейшего перебора" Для меня новость, что метод перебора может что-то оптимизировать.. По моим понятиям - разве только расчеты на бумажке, и то не всегда.. Может, я ошибаюсь? PS тема переезжает в Алгоритмы.. -------------------- я - ветер, я северный холодный ветер
я час расставанья, я год возвращенья домой |
.helga |
Сообщение
#3
|
Новичок Группа: Пользователи Сообщений: 26 Пол: Женский Репутация: 1 |
2Lapp
а задача о назначениях? это же задача на оптимизацию. которую ты решал перебором. 2 bigglewood если это то, что я думаю, то почитай вот здесь: задача о назначаниях |
Lapp |
Сообщение
#4
|
Уникум Группа: Пользователи Сообщений: 6 823 Пол: Мужской Реальное имя: Лопáрь (Андрей) Репутация: 159 |
2Lapp а задача о назначениях? это же задача на оптимизацию. которую ты решал перебором. Логично! Что-то я зарапортовался... условие понял превратно. Извиняюсь! -------------------- я - ветер, я северный холодный ветер
я час расставанья, я год возвращенья домой |
imperfect |
Сообщение
#5
|
Группа: Пользователи Сообщений: 5 Пол: Мужской Репутация: 0 |
помогите пожалуйста найти пример оптимизации методом "простейшего перебора" спасибо. Товарищи отписались маленько не в тему Жаль я этого вовремя не увидел. Так или иначе, хочется восстановить справедливость. Оптимизация - поиск минимума. Простейший перебор - лично для меня новый термин. Скорее всего, это что-то типа варварского численного метода, заключающегося в разбиении интервала определения на фикс.кол-во отрезков и определение того, который дает минимум. Для трехмерного случая - сетка значений. Проще я просто выдумать не могу. Сложнее - пожалуйста... -------------------- Код while(1)cout<<":)"<<endl; |
volvo |
Сообщение
#6
|
Гость |
Цитата Оптимизация - поиск минимума. А это надо указывать в вопросе, простите... У слова "оптимизация" далеко не одно значение, так что еще не известно, кто здесь Цитата маленько не в тему ... Ты откуда знаешь, ЧТО имелось в виду автором?Выражение "скорее всего" это по-твоему, "точно в тему"? Так что просьба - пока автор не уточнит, ЧТО имелось в виду - больше гаданием на кофейной (и любой другой) гуще НЕ занимаемся... |
imperfect |
Сообщение
#7
|
Группа: Пользователи Сообщений: 5 Пол: Мужской Репутация: 0 |
да, я был прав
Метод перебора или равномерного поиска является простейшим из прямых методов минимизации и состоит в следующем. Разобьем отрезок [a,b] на n равных частей точками деления: xi=a+i(b-a)/n, i=0,...n Вычислив значения F(x) в точках xi, путем сравнения найдем точку xm, где m - это число от 0 до n, такую, что F(xm) = min F(xi) для всех i от 0 до n. Погрешность определения точки минимума xm функции F(x) методом перебора не превосходит величены Eps=(b-a)/n. Сообщение отредактировано: imperfect - -------------------- Код while(1)cout<<":)"<<endl; |
imperfect |
Сообщение
#8
|
Группа: Пользователи Сообщений: 5 Пол: Мужской Репутация: 0 |
Маленький ликбезик
Оптимизация - нахождение минимума функции множества аргументов Методы оптимизации делятся на аналитические и численные Численные, наиболее часто используемые (аналитические - оффтоп): - Множителей Лагранжа - Ньютона - BGFS - Фибоначчи - Градиентного спуска - Покоординатного спуска - Сжимающихся многогранников - Вариационного исчисления - Симплекс Сообщение отредактировано: imperfect - -------------------- Код while(1)cout<<":)"<<endl; |
Michael_Rybak |
Сообщение
#9
|
Michael_Rybak Группа: Пользователи Сообщений: 1 046 Пол: Мужской Реальное имя: Michael_Rybak Репутация: 32 |
Цитата Оптимизация - нахождение минимума функции множества аргументов Такой "ликбезик" в лучшем случае подошел бьі на подфоруме "Математика", но никак не в "Алгоритмы" http://ru.wikipedia.org/wiki/%D0%9E%D0%BF%...%86%D0%B8%D1%8F * Оптимизация (вычислительная техника). В вычислительной технике оптимизацией называется процесс модификации системы для улучшения её эффективности. Система может быть одиночной компьютерной программой, набором компьютеров или даже целой сетью, такой как Internet. * Оптимизация (математика). В математике оптимизация связана с нахождением оптимума (т.е. максимума или минимума) некоторой функции при выполнении некоторых ограничений. |
imperfect |
Сообщение
#10
|
Группа: Пользователи Сообщений: 5 Пол: Мужской Репутация: 0 |
Такой "ликбезик" в лучшем случае подошел бьі на подфоруме "Математика", но никак не в "Алгоритмы" Как раз таки наоборот! У каждого из перечисленных методов свои численные алгоритмы нахождения локальных экстремумов, зачастую оченно оригинальные. Хотя и математика тут тоже есть... -------------------- Код while(1)cout<<":)"<<endl; |
Michael_Rybak |
Сообщение
#11
|
Michael_Rybak Группа: Пользователи Сообщений: 1 046 Пол: Мужской Реальное имя: Michael_Rybak Репутация: 32 |
Ничего не наоборот.
У каждого из этих методов свои алгоритмы, но *приемов оптимизации алгоритмов* несравненно больше, чем *алгоритмов оптимизации*. И давай перестанем флеймить, автор давно усоп, по крайней мере по этому вопросу. |
Текстовая версия | 22.12.2024 15:18 |